The Orchestre de la Suisse Romande, established in 1918 by the esteemed conductor Ernest Ansermet, is one of Europe's most venerable and historically significant orchestras. Hailing from the culturally rich city of Geneva, Switzerland, this ensemble boasts an impressive discography that spans over a century of musical excellence. Under Ansermet's leadership and beyond, the orchestra has performed and recorded a wide array of repertoire, from the romantic works of Dvořák and Strauss to the innovative compositions of Ravel and Borodin.
